Output e44963edf5f90bcb357ac3e65cf39d67fc89a66a83d8358bfbd67f9924b1669e:0

value
18606507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 951696e6e96d5e1db80de93de29101c4d6769556 OP_EQUAL
address
MMVTyZDFV6rxYU9GTGHGv8qg9PV6TdYFt7
transaction
e44963edf5f90bcb357ac3e65cf39d67fc89a66a83d8358bfbd67f9924b1669e
spent
true